India, Sept. 30 -- While Canada designated the Lawrence Bishnoi gang as a terrorist entity on Monday, India had in the past warned Ottawa several times about its activities.

Those warnings were delivered in 2021 and in 2022 but were largely ignored by the government of then Canadian prime minister Justin Trudeau before it accused India last year of using the gang members to target pro-Khalistan separatists based in Canada.

The matter was discussed by officials of the National Investigation Agency (NIA) when they visited Ottawa in 2021 for talks with their Canadian counterparts.
